How Many Students Attend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ute?

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ute total enrollment is approximately 441 students.

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ute Undergraduate Population

Male/Female Breakdown of Undergraduates

The full-time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ute undergraduate population is made up of 55.6% women, and 44.4% men.

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ute Racial/Ethnic Breakdown of Undergraduates

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ute Undergraduate Racial-Ethnic Diversity Pie Chart
Race/Ethnicity Number Percent
White 400 90.7%
Black or African American 11 2.5%
Multi-Ethnic 11 2.5%
Unknown 9 2.0%
Hispanic 8 1.8%
Asian 2 0.5%

Geographic Diversity

0.0% Out of State

Among first-time degree-seeking undergraduates, 100.0% of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ute students come from within the state, and 0.0% come from out of state. Where are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ute students from?

The undergraduate student body is split among 4 states (may include Washington D.C.). Click on the map for more detail.

Where are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ute students from?

Top 5 States

State Amount Percent
Ohio 239 98.0%
Pennsylvania 3 1.2%
Indiana 1 0.4%
Michigan 1 0.4%

Student Age Diversity

89.7% Traditional College Age

A traditional college student is defined as being between the ages of 18-21. At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ute, 89.7% of undergraduate students fall into that category, compared to the national average of 60%. Ohio State University Agricultural Technical Institute Student Age Diversity

Student Age Group Amount Percent
18-19 369 74.8%
20-21 73 14.8%
Under 18 29 5.9%
22-24 10 2.0%
25-29 6 1.2%
35 and over 5 1.0%
30-34 1 0.2%

*The racial-ethnic minorities count is calculated by taking the total number of students and subtracting white students, international students, and students whose race/ethnicity was unknown. This number is then divided by the total number of students at the school to obtain the racial-ethnic minorities percentage.
